Spoke count trick - sight down the parallel spokes at the valve. Are there matching parallel spokes at the label or are they crossed. Matching - even number of pairs per side, ie 24, 32 or 40 spokes. Not matching - 28, 36,

Originally Posted by 79pmooney
I see 32 (count 'em) spokes on each wheel. Anyone know what those rims weigh? And - can that freehub take a Campy 9-speed cassette? (Yes to that last and I am very interested.)
At the catalogue 395gms for the rim only. Add 1.52gms per eyelet for tubular rims… so 444gms more or less for 32h Lambda Strada tubular…

Amazing how some of the Campagnolo trivia remains unforgotten 35 years later. Not the actual weights, just that rims and eyelets were listed separately, had to look up the actual figures…
